Output 75aa0a6027d1f107e86278afc1467c82e5a91bfcc6bc2ff62d54ba1a0df6e79d:47

value
2852674
script pubkey
OP_0 OP_PUSHBYTES_20 edd34512c6593bda61d3b4eb81d56a373fb2ffd3
address
bc1qahf52ykxtyaa5cwnkn4cr4t2xulm9l7ngkseeg
transaction
75aa0a6027d1f107e86278afc1467c82e5a91bfcc6bc2ff62d54ba1a0df6e79d
spent
true